Heim > Datenbank > MySQL-Tutorial > MySQL-Änderungsdaten

MySQL-Änderungsdaten

王林
Freigeben: 2023-05-14 10:58:07
Original
5600 Leute haben es durchsucht

MySQL ist ein relationales Open-Source-Datenbankverwaltungssystem mit den Vorteilen geringer Kosten, einfacher Erweiterung und hoher Zuverlässigkeit. Es wird häufig in verschiedenen Unternehmensbereichen eingesetzt. Im eigentlichen Bewerbungsprozess müssen die Daten in MySQL häufig geändert und aktualisiert werden. In diesem Artikel wird erläutert, wie MySQL Datenänderungen durchführt.

1. Überblick über die SQL-Sprache

SQL „Structured Query Language“ ist eine Standardsprache zum Hinzufügen, Löschen, Ändern, Abfragen und Verwalten von Daten. SQL umfasst drei Teile: Datendefinition, Datenoperation und Datensteuerung:

1 Datendefinitionssprache (DDL): einschließlich Erstellen, Ändern und Löschen von Datenbanken, Tabellen, Spalten usw.

2. Datenmanipulationssprache (DML): einschließlich Abfrage-, Einfüge-, Aktualisierungs- und Löschvorgänge.

3. Data Control Language (DCL): umfasst Vorgänge wie die Berechtigungskontrolle.

2. So ändern Sie Daten

1. Wenn einige Felder in den Daten geändert werden müssen, können Sie das Schlüsselwort UPDATE verwenden, um ein einzelnes Datenelement zu aktualisieren folgt:

UPDATE 表名 SET 字段1=值1,字段2=值2,... WHERE 条件
Nach dem Login kopieren

Unter ihnen folgt auf SET die geänderten Felder und ihre Werte, gefolgt von WHERE sind die Bedingungen, die erfüllt sind. Um beispielsweise das Feld „Alter“ eines Benutzers, dessen Feld „Name“ in der Tabelle „Benutzer“ „Tom“ lautet, in „25“ zu ändern, können Sie den folgenden Code verwenden:

UPDATE users SET age=25 WHERE name='Tom';
Nach dem Login kopieren

Zu diesem Zeitpunkt wird MySQL zurückkehren eine erfolgreiche Änderung Anzahl der Datensätze.

2. Mehrere Datenelemente aktualisieren

Wenn Sie mehrere Datensätze gleichzeitig ändern müssen, können Sie die folgende Syntax verwenden:

UPDATE 表名 SET 字段1=值1, 字段2=值2,... WHERE 条件
Nach dem Login kopieren

Die Grundstruktur dieser Anweisung ist dieselbe wie die Syntax zum Aktualisieren eines einzelnen Datenelements von Daten, mit der Ausnahme, dass Batch-Änderungen in den WHERE-Bedingungen hinzugefügt werden müssen. Um beispielsweise die Benutzer zu ändern, deren Feld „Alter“ in der Tabelle „Benutzer“ größer als „20“ und deren Feld „Name“ in „John“ ist, können Sie den folgenden Code verwenden:

UPDATE users SET name='John' WHERE age>20;
Nach dem Login kopieren

Zu diesem Zeitpunkt MySQL gibt die Anzahl der erfolgreich geänderten Datensätze zurück.

3. Mehrere Felder aktualisieren

Beim Aktualisieren mehrerer Felder müssen Sie SET mit allen zu ändernden Feldern und den entsprechenden neuen Werten befolgen. Um beispielsweise das Feld „Alter“ des Benutzers, dessen Feld „Name“ in der Tabelle „Benutzer“ „Lucy“ lautet, in „20“ und das Feld „Geschlecht“ in „weiblich“ zu ändern, können Sie den folgenden Code verwenden:

UPDATE users SET age=20, gender='female' WHERE name='Lucy';
Nach dem Login kopieren

Zu diesem Zeitpunkt gibt MySQL die Anzahl der erfolgreich geänderten Datensätze zurück.

4. Ändern Sie die Tabellenstruktur

Wenn Sie die Tabellenstruktur ändern müssen, können Sie die von MySQL bereitgestellte ALTER TABLE-Anweisung verwenden. Diese Anweisung kann Spalten in der Tabelle hinzufügen, ändern oder löschen und der Tabelle auch Einschränkungen usw. hinzufügen. Um beispielsweise eine Spalte mit dem Namen „Adresse“ zur Tabelle „Benutzer“ hinzuzufügen, können Sie den folgenden Code verwenden:

ALTER TABLE users ADD COLUMN address VARCHAR(100);
Nach dem Login kopieren

Zu diesem Zeitpunkt gibt MySQL „OK“ zurück, was anzeigt, dass das Hinzufügen erfolgreich war.

5. Daten löschen

In MySQL können Sie die DELETE-Anweisung verwenden, um bestimmte Daten zu löschen. Die grundlegende Syntax der DELETE-Anweisung lautet wie folgt:

DELETE FROM 表名 WHERE 条件
Nach dem Login kopieren

Darunter folgt auf FROM der Name der zu löschenden Tabelle und auf WHERE die Bedingungen der Datenzeilen, die gelöscht werden müssen. Um beispielsweise alle Benutzer zu löschen, deren Feld „Geschlecht“ in der Tabelle „Benutzer“ „männlich“ ist, können Sie den folgenden Code verwenden:

DELETE FROM users WHERE gender='male';
Nach dem Login kopieren

Zu diesem Zeitpunkt gibt MySQL die Anzahl der erfolgreich gelöschten Datensätze zurück.

3. Zusammenfassung

MySQL ist ein leistungsstarkes Datenbankverwaltungssystem, das eine schnelle und effiziente Datenverarbeitung und -verwaltung ermöglicht. Mithilfe der SQL-Sprache können Sie Daten in MySQL hinzufügen, löschen, ändern und andere Vorgänge ausführen. Dieser Artikel stellt verschiedene Möglichkeiten zum Ändern von Daten in MySQL vor und hofft, den Lesern hilfreich zu sein. Im tatsächlichen Betrieb müssen Sie entsprechend der tatsächlichen Situation die geeignete Methode auswählen und auf die Datensicherung achten, um Datenverlust zu verhindern.

Das obige ist der detaillierte Inhalt vonMySQL-Änderungsdaten.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age